As an ALN Teaching Assistant, you will play a key role in helping pupils access learning, develop confidence, and achieve their individual goals within a supportive school environment.

The Role

As a Teaching Assistant, your responsibilities may include:

  • Providing one-to-one support for pupils with additional learning needs.
  • Assisting small groups to access classroom activities and learning tasks.
  • Supporting pupils with communication, social and emotional development.
  • Working closely with class teachers and ALN coordinators to implement support strategies.
  • Encouraging independence while maintaining a safe and nurturing environment.
  • Celebrating progress and helping pupils build confidence both inside and outside the classroom.

Who We're Looking For

We would love to hear from Teaching Assistants who have:

  • Experience supporting children with ALN, SEN, autism, ADHD, speech and language needs, or behavioural challenges.
  • Previous experience within education, childcare, care work, youth work, sports coaching or similar support roles.
  • A patient, resilient and positive attitude.
  • Excellent communication and relationship-building skills.
  • A genuine passion for helping children overcome barriers to learning.

All pay rates quoted will be inclusive of 12.07% statutory holiday pay. This advert is for a temporary position. In some cases, the option to make this role permanent may become available at a later date.
Teaching Personnel is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children. We undertake safeguarding checks on all workers in accordance with DfE statutory guidance ‘Keeping Children Safe in Education’ this may also include an online search as part of our due diligence on shortlisted applicants.
We offer all our registered candidates FREE child protection and prevent duty training. All candidates must undertake or have undertaken a valid enhanced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S) check. Full assistance provided.
